Riyadh – Mubasher: The financial statements of Saudi Cement Company showed an increase in profits by 12.7% in 2019.

Annual net profit after zakat and tax amounted to SAR 451.4 million last year, compared with SAR 400.5 million for 2018.

The rise in profits is attributed to higher sales, despite an increase in general and administrative costs, as well as sales and distribution costs and finance expenses.

During the fourth quarter (Q4) of 2019, net profit grew by 15% to SAR 143.6 million, compared with SAR 124.8 million for the same period in the year before.
